Before You Start
Preparation prevents most problems. Before you sign up, check the following five points to avoid surprises later:
- Licensing: Confirm the operator holds a U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) licence. This is non-negotiable for player protection in the UK. If you play on a Curacao-licensed site, remember that winnings may be subject to local income tax, unlike UKGC-regulated casinos where gambling winnings are generally tax-free.
- Payment methods: Verify that your preferred deposit and withdrawal options are available. Common methods include debit cards, e-wallets like PayPal or Skrill, and bank transfers. Check whether any fees apply to withdrawals.
- Withdrawal limits: Look for maximum and minimum withdrawal amounts. Some casinos cap monthly withdrawals, which can affect high rollers.
- Wagering requirements: Read the bonus terms carefully. A 35x wagering requirement on a £100 bonus means you must wager £3,500 before you can withdraw any winnings from that bonus.
- Verification documents: Have your ID, proof of address, and payment method screenshots ready. Quick verification speeds up your first withdrawal.
- Responsible gambling tools: Check if the casino offers deposit limits, session reminders, and self-exclusion. These tools are essential for safe play.

How Wagering Works
Wagering requirements are the most misunderstood aspect of online casino bonuses. In simple terms, the wagering requirement is the total amount you must bet before you can withdraw any bonus winnings. Let’s break it down with a real-world example.
Suppose you deposit £100 and receive a 100% match bonus of £100. The casino states a 35x wagering requirement on the bonus amount. The total you must wager is:
Wagering requirement = Bonus amount × Wagering multiplier = £100 × 35 = £3,500
This means you must place bets totalling £3,500 before the bonus funds become withdrawable. If you only play slots that contribute 100% to the wagering, every £1 you bet counts fully. However, if you play blackjack, which typically contributes only 10%, you would need to wager £35,000 to meet the same requirement:
Effective wagering = £3,500 / 0.10 = £35,000
Let’s calculate the expected loss. If the slot you play has a house edge of 3% (RTP 97%), your expected loss over £3,500 of wagering is:
Expected loss = Wagering amount × House edge = £3,500 × 0.03 = £105
Since your bonus is £100, the expected value is:
Expected value = Bonus amount – Expected loss = £100 – £105 = -£5
So, in this case, the bonus has a slightly negative expected value. To make a positive EV, look for lower wagering requirements (e.g., 20x) or higher RTP games. For a 20x requirement on the same bonus:
Wagering = £100 × 20 = £2,000; Expected loss = £2,000 × 0.03 = £60; EV = £100 – £60 = +£40
That is a positive expected value, but you must still complete the wagering. Always check the game contribution percentages in the terms.

Deposits & Withdrawals
Deposits at a casino instant site are usually instantaneous. Here is a typical breakdown of methods and processing times:
| Payment Method | Deposit Time | Withdrawal Time | Typical Fees |
|---|---|---|---|
| Debit Card (Visa/Mastercard) | Instant | 1–3 business days | Free (sometimes) |
| E-wallet (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ller) | Instant | Under 24 hours | Free or small fee |
| Bank Transfer | 1–3 business days | 3–7 business days | May incur fee |
| Prepaid Cards (Paysafecard) | Instant | Not available (withdrawal to bank) | Free |
For withdrawals, the fastest method is usually e-wallets. However, note that some casinos require you to withdraw using the same method you deposited with. If you deposit via credit card, you may need to withdraw to that card up to the deposit amount, with any winnings sent to your bank account.
Always check the minimum and maximum withdrawal limits. Many casinos have a daily or monthly withdrawal cap. For example, a £5,000 monthly limit means you cannot withdraw more than that in a calendar month, regardless of your winnings.
Withdrawal processing times can be longer during KYC verification. To speed things up, complete verification immediately after registration, even before you make your first deposit.

Pro Tips
Responsible gambling is not just a slogan — it is the smartest strategy. Here are practical tips using the tools most UK casinos provide:
- Set a deposit limit: Decide on a monthly deposit cap that you can afford to lose without affecting your bills. You can adjust this limit in your account settings, but increases take 24 hours to take effect, giving you time to reconsider.
- Use session limits: Set a reminder to play for no more than 60 minutes at a time. Take a break to keep your judgement clear.
- Self-exclusion: If you feel you are losing control, use the self-exclusion tool to block access to the casino for 6 months, 1 year, or more. This is a binding agreement with the operator.
- Never chase losses: If you lose £100, do not increase your bets to try to win it back. Stick to your limits.
- Treat bonuses as entertainment: As shown in the wagering calculations, bonuses can have negative expected value. Only use them if you understand the requirements and enjoy the play.
